diff --git a/.hurry b/.hurry index dc2162d..fa2815b 100644 --- a/.hurry +++ b/.hurry @@ -1,7 +1,7 @@ config: username: MoniGoMani Community exchange: binance - ft_binary: source ./.env/bin/activate; freqtrade + ft_binary: . ./.env/bin/activate; freqtrade hyperopt: epochs: 1000 loss: MGM_WinRatioAndProfitRatioHyperOptLoss diff --git a/mgm-hurry b/mgm-hurry index f0b36ab..674a893 100755 --- a/mgm-hurry +++ b/mgm-hurry @@ -450,7 +450,7 @@ class MGMHurry: """ if answers.get('install_type') == 'source': - ft_binary = f'source {self.basedir}/.env/bin/activate; freqtrade' + ft_binary = f'. {self.basedir}/.env/bin/activate; freqtrade' else: ft_binary = 'docker-compose run --rm freqtrade' """ @@ -458,7 +458,7 @@ class MGMHurry: 'config': { 'username': answers.get('username'), 'install_type': 'source', # answers.get('install_type'), - 'ft_binary': f'source {self.basedir}/.env/bin/activate; freqtrade', # ft_binary, + 'ft_binary': f'. {self.basedir}/.env/bin/activate; freqtrade', # ft_binary, 'timerange': answers.get('timerange'), 'exchange': exchange or 'none', 'hyperopt': { diff --git a/user_data/mgm_tools/Freqtrade-Download-Pairs.sh b/user_data/mgm_tools/Freqtrade-Download-Pairs.sh index 890ed5c..ccbeaad 100644 --- a/user_data/mgm_tools/Freqtrade-Download-Pairs.sh +++ b/user_data/mgm_tools/Freqtrade-Download-Pairs.sh @@ -78,7 +78,7 @@ fi # switch to freqtrade venv cd ${FQT_DIR}; -source .env/bin/activate ; +. .env/bin/activate ; # loop through exchanges for EXCHANGE in ${EXCHANGES[@]} diff --git a/user_data/mgm_tools/mgm_hurry/FreqtradeCli.py b/user_data/mgm_tools/mgm_hurry/FreqtradeCli.py index 42d9d93..7e55778 100644 --- a/user_data/mgm_tools/mgm_hurry/FreqtradeCli.py +++ b/user_data/mgm_tools/mgm_hurry/FreqtradeCli.py @@ -328,7 +328,7 @@ class FreqtradeCli: freqtrade_binary = 'docker-compose run --rm freqtrade' if install_type == 'source': - freqtrade_binary = f'source {basedir}/.env/bin/activate; freqtrade' + freqtrade_binary = f'. {basedir}/.env/bin/activate; freqtrade' return freqtrade_binary